基于数据驱动的方法分析与结石相关的饮食模式:上海的一项病例对照研究

概括
这项研究确定了与结石疾病 (KSD) 相关的饮食模式. 含糖饮料是危险因素,而酸菜和甲动物对KSD有保护作用.

背景情况:
- 结石疾病 (KSD) 造成了严重的健康负担.
- 饮食因素越来越被认为是KSD的可修改风险因素.
- 了解与KSD相关的特定饮食模式对于预防至关重要.
研究的目的:
- 用数据驱动的方法分析饮食模式.
- 为了确定预防性和风险的食因素,结石疾病 (KSD).
- 探索与KSD的性别特异性饮食关联.
主要方法:
- 一项涉及上海6396名成年人的病例控制研究.
- 食物频率调查问卷评估了饮食摄入量.
- 主要成分分析,回归,LASSO回归和选择后推断确定了饮食模式和相关的食物组.
主要成果:
- 在男性中",均衡但不含糖的饮料"和"坚果和酸菜"模式具有保护作用.
- 在女性中",高蔬菜和低糖饮料"和"高甲动物和低蔬菜"模式具有保护作用.
- 糖饮料被确定为危险因素,而酸菜和甲动物是KSD的保护因素.
结论:
- 饮食模式显著影响结石疾病的风险.
- 特定的食物群体,如含糖饮料,酸菜和甲类动物,与KSD风险有明显的关联.
- 根据已识别的模式量身定制的饮食建议可能有助于预防KSD.

Urinary Tract Calculi I: Introduction
Renal calculi, or kidney stones, are solid deposits of minerals and salts formed inside the kidneys. In medical terminology, "calculus" refers to the stone itself, while "lithiasis" describes the process of stone formation. Depending on their location within the urinary system, these stones may be classified as either urolithiasis, when situated within the urinary tract, or nephrolithiasis, when located within the kidneys. Urinary Tract Calculi III: Medical Management
The diagnosis of renal calculi involves several imaging techniques, including non-contrast CT scans and ultrasound. These methods help visualize kidney stones, assess their size and location, and detect possible obstructions. Additionally, Measuring urine pH is useful for diagnosing specific stone types, such as struvite (alkaline pH) and uric acid stones (acidic pH).
